Transaction 11bbcd70f406abd95ccc6f509745bbbceaa8e8537046878d43e90babf838a37f

1 Input
1 Outputs
  • 11bbcd70f406abd95ccc6f509745bbbceaa8e8537046878d43e90babf838a37f:0
  • value  476599
    address  3MHEusioawd6TnNFSMpVVoZ1f6h8otvxcU